Rootstock

A rootstock is the root system and the lower part of the stem onto which a cultivated variety is grafted. It serves as the foundation of the plant, determining its vitality, vigor, time to fruit-bearing, and resistance to external conditions.

A rootstock is the root system and lower stem used for grafting a cultivated variety. It determines tree size, planting density, and the timing of fruit-bearing. Depending on the rootstock type, plants can range from vigorous with high longevity to dwarf, suitable for intensive orchards that require support.

The effectiveness of a rootstock depends on its adaptation to the soil and climatic conditions of the site, including response to groundwater levels, salinity, as well as winter hardiness and drought tolerance. An important factor is resistance to specific soil pathogens, which in many crops is provided precisely by the rootstock.

The choice of rootstock is evaluated through the scion-rootstock combination and the orchard's technological map. Vigorous seedling rootstocks provide longevity, while clonal rootstocks allow for controlling growth vigor and accelerating yield. A poor selection can lead to incompatibility, reduced productivity, or tree death.
